Panasonic FH10 vs Sony QX1 Physical Comparison

For those who are intending to carry around your camera often, you'll need to consider its weight and proportions. The Panasonic FH10 enjoys physical dimensions of 94mm x 54mm x 18mm (3.7" x 2.1" x 0.7") along with a weight of 103 grams (0.23 lbs) while the Sony QX1 has measurements of 74mm x 70mm x 53mm (2.9" x 2.8" x 2.1") accompanied by a weight of 216 grams (0.48 lbs).

Panasonic FH10 vs Sony QX1 Sensor Comparison

Typically, it's tough to picture the difference between sensor sizes simply by looking at a spec sheet. The pic below should give you a stronger sense of the sensor dimensions in the FH10 and QX1.

As you can see, both of the cameras come with different megapixels and different sensor sizes. The FH10 having a tinier sensor is going to make shooting shallower depth of field more challenging and the Sony QX1 will give you more detail having an extra 4MP. Greater resolution will also make it easier to crop images a good deal more aggressively. The more aged FH10 is going to be disadvantaged with regard to sensor innovation.
